  • Abstract
    High-density recording requires longitudinal magnetic recording media with high coercivity and low noise. We report our studies of magnetic and microstructural properties of high-coersivity CoCrTa films. A coercivity of 2450 Oe has been obtained by applying a high bias voltage to the substrate. Microstructural analysis by TEM and electron diffraction studies revealed that in high-coercivity film c-axes are strongly oriented in the film plane.
